Value of strain elastography combined with TIRADS in differential diagnosis of benign and malignant thyroid nodules
Objective To investigate the value of strain elastography combined with thyroid imaging reporting and data system(TIRADS)in the differential diagnosis of benign and malignant thyroid nodules.Methods A total of 82 patients with thyroid nodules who were treated in the Third Affiliated Hospital of Xuzhou Medical University from January 2020 to January 2023 were selected.All patients underwent strain ultrasound elastography and TIRADS score.With pathological examination as the gold standard for diagnosis,the subjects were divided into malignant group(n=8)and benign group(n=74).Logistic regression model was used to screen the independent predictors of malignant thyroid nodules.ROC curve was used to evaluate the efficacy of strain elastography,elastic strain ratio(SR),TIRADS score and their combination in the diagnosis of benign and malignant thyroid nodules.Results There were significant differences in strain ultrasound elastography score,SR and TIRADS score between the two groups(P<0.05).Multivariate Logistic regression analysis showed that strain ultrasound elastography score,SR and TIRADS score were independent predictors of malignant thyroid nodules,with OR values of 1.675,1.550 and 1.476,respectively(P<0.05).ROC curve analysis showed that the area under the curve of strain ultrasound elastography score,SR,TIRADS score and the combination of the three in the diagnosis of malignant thyroid nodules were 0.794,0.919,0.875,0.994,respectively,and the combination of the three had the highest diagnostic value(P<0.001).Conclusion Strain elastography and TIRADS have certain value in the differential diagnosis of benign and malignant thyroid nodules.The combination of the two methods can improve the diagnostic efficiency.
